7 Days trip in Perugia, Italy
Perugia is a charming city located in the region of Umbria in central Italy. Known for its rich history, stunning architecture, and picturesque landscapes, Perugia attracts visitors from around the world. With its well-preserved medieval old town and vibrant cultural scene, the city offers a perfect blend of ancient traditions and modern amenities.
